Leaks from Telecom call centres?

The example leaks seemed to come from call centres selling mobile phones rather than from banks.

Some leaks were from voice phone calls with call centres rather than from computer or Internet data.

This shows that *any* remote transaction with *any* retailer can be a risk.

Perhaps the banks should review their checks of companies which apply for "merchant accounts."
